DiRoma Pizzeria

Modern authentic Italian on Glebe Road, Merewether

A takeaway, fast casual pizzeria with the option of BYO, free of charge.

If you have driven along Glebe Road recently you might have spotted a new little pizzeria on the corner called DiRoma. As a self-confessed pizza enthusiast, it shot straight to the top of my new-things-to-try-in-Newcastle list.

And I am here to tell you it did not disappoint. Think 4 Formaggi with a Crème Fraiche base, Italian buffalo mozzarella, gorgonzola dolce, feta and grated parmigiano. Classic margarita pizza, pastas, plus dessert such as a Nutella pizza...YUM!

When I think authentic Italian pizza I think a classic Neapolitan pizza. However, the owner of DiRoma, Riccardo, explains that this is not necessarily the case.

“… it is just because it is the most promoted. Where I come from, Italy is divided into three- North, Centre and South. I am from the North and I have never had the pizza from the South. People from the South are like ‘no no the real pizza is this’, so this is a conflict.

"So we say, he (his business partner) is from the South, I’m from the North, why don’t we do a combination? So we joined the base and the toppings and we do a Roman style, the right balance."

Besides the name DiRoma being his business partner's family name, DiRoma means ‘from Rome’ which adds to this idea of the perfect balanced pizza from the middle of Italy.

Having previously owned pizza businesses in Sydney and Forster, Riccardo has now settled in Newcastle, the perfect in-between city. And since its opening a little over a week ago Novocastrians have been keeping them hot on their feet!
